Hey got a question.. why is there a oily like substance coming out of the suction cup part of the flyback of my asteroids go5 monitor?? not like its leaking just all wet looking around the area (thats what she said! lol)

anyone know?
 
From what I have been told it is the plasticizer material they use in the manufacture of the rubber leeching out over time.

Space invaders anode wires are notorious for this as well.
 
Some people put silicone grease around the anode hole for some reason also....
